    Company Description
    Located in a renovated, textile mill built in the mid-1800s in downtown Lewiston, Maine, Baxter Brewing Company is one of the fastest growing breweries in the Northeast. Baxter’s beers can be found throughout New England, New Jersey, and eastern New York. Baxter was the first brewery in New England to can 100% of its craft beer offerings.
    Baxter’s beers are as individual and creative as its brewers who strive to brew stylistically correct and incredibly balanced beers. Baxter’s beers provide a gateway to the craft beer community while also maintaining a high level of quality and taste for craft beer veterans. The brand is neither oversimplified nor inaccessible.
    Job Overview
    The Accounting Administrator is responsible for many of the core Administrative and Accounting functions at Baxter Brewing Co. This position works closely with the Controller, Production, Sales, and Warehouse Teams.
    Essential Duties and Responsibilities
    • Working with the brewing staff to gather data to ensure that the system (Orchestrated Beer) matches what is physically happening in the brewery.
    • Monthly inventory counts for the brewing area.
    • Processing goods receipts, orders, credits, payments and other tasks as necessary.
    • Weekly entry of taproom activity
    • Counting cash and preparing deposits.
    • Process weekly Keg inventory activity
    • Other duties as assigned.

    Desired Minimum Qualifications
    • Associates degree or higher in Accounting with 2-4 years of work experience in an accounting role.
    • Proven ability in computer software such as spreadsheets, word processors, and enterprise software.
    • Experience in a brewery or with the Orchestrated Beer software is a big plus
    • A passion for craft beer, and ability to embrace Baxter’s core values

    Knowledge & Skills
    •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written
    • Strong computer skills, including word processing, and spreadsheets
    • Excellent organizational abilities
    • Proven ability to streamline and make processes more efficient
    • Ability to learn new software systems
    • Ability to analyze and solve problems
    • Ability to focus amongst multiple distractions, and to multitask
    • Basic understanding of G/L accounts a MUST
    • Enterprise Software Experience a plus



    Compensation and Benefits
    Baxter Brewing Company offers competitive wages that will be determined by experience. Additionally we offer health/vision insurance; dental insurance; retirement planning with a company match up to 3% of salary; paid time off; a killer work environment; and there’s beer. Complete details are outlined in the Baxter Employee Handbook. The hours for this position at 8:00am to 4:30pm M-F with some flexibility. Pay will be commensurate with experience.
